Treść przeznaczona dla osób powyżej 18 roku życia...
Wszystko
Najnowsze
Archiwum

konto usunięte
- 0
OlekAleksander
- 2
@wujekmundek: Ja bym tak nie przesadzal z tym GitHubem jak nie ma doswiadczenia, bo mozliwe, ze nawet tam nie zagladaja. Sory, ale teraz na juniora dostaja tyle cv, ze watpie, zeby przegladali ich kody, przy kilku cv juz ciezko, zeby wszystkie repozytoria ktos ogladal a teraz dostaja duzo wiecej niz kilka cv.

aso824
via Wykop Mobilny (Android)- 2
@Trochutak: IMO jeden dobrze zrobiony projekt na GH który żyje tzn jest postawiony i osiągalny pod domeną. To możesz wpisać w CV w jakiejś sekcji "projekty", możesz tym zainteresować rekrutera, a ew. programista sprawdzający kod ma już na co spojrzeć. Podepnij w takim projekcie narzędzia CI typu Travis, poczytaj o phpunit czy phpstan. Takimi rzeczami jesteś w stanie się wybić jak masz solidne podstawy. Możesz też prosić o CR tutaj
Mam backup mysql jako dump 100GB. Nie pytajcie czemu. Jakie są strategie aby to backupować jakoś sensownie?
Myślałem o jakiejś replikacji master slave aby nie zapisywać tych spakowanych dumpów cyklicznie co X czasu. Nie dość, że to w uj trwa to tak samo długo trwa przywracanie. Profesjonalny admin #linux musi to robić inaczej bo nie wierzę, że tak to musi działać.
I jak to wogóle ma się zdumpować dobrze jeśli
Myślałem o jakiejś replikacji master slave aby nie zapisywać tych spakowanych dumpów cyklicznie co X czasu. Nie dość, że to w uj trwa to tak samo długo trwa przywracanie. Profesjonalny admin #linux musi to robić inaczej bo nie wierzę, że tak to musi działać.
I jak to wogóle ma się zdumpować dobrze jeśli
- 4
@incydent_kakaowy: profesjonalny admin linux nie używa mysql.
@incydent_kakaowy: Pro admin / DevOps robi to dwupoziomowo, ale uprzedzam, ze mowimy tu o drogich zabawkach:
1) Problem holdowania bazy celem zrobienia bakckupu - tak sie nie robi na duzych bazach. Nie robi sie dumpow (te moga sluzyc ewentualnie do migracji), a korzysta z enterprise'owego oprogramowania do backupow (Commvault, EMC Networker, Veeam). ktore to wszystkie posiadaja dedytkowane do konkretnych silnikow bazodanowych pluginy dla systemow operacyjnych na ktorych rozne bazy pracuja. Pluginy
1) Problem holdowania bazy celem zrobienia bakckupu - tak sie nie robi na duzych bazach. Nie robi sie dumpow (te moga sluzyc ewentualnie do migracji), a korzysta z enterprise'owego oprogramowania do backupow (Commvault, EMC Networker, Veeam). ktore to wszystkie posiadaja dedytkowane do konkretnych silnikow bazodanowych pluginy dla systemow operacyjnych na ktorych rozne bazy pracuja. Pluginy
- 0
Ostatnio jakiś Mirek pytał o #szyfrowanie #jsi node. A ja pytam o #php . Przykładowo mam jakiś panel www - chcę go udostępnić klientowi, aby mógł zainstalować lokalnie na swoim kompie (tutaj też pytanie o to, czy da się od razu z wbudowanym serwerem #apache #mysql) , ale nie chcę aby mógł podglądnąć/skopiować/edytować kod. Wiem, że pewnie rozwiązań jest dużo, ale
Możesz utworzyć aplikację z użyciem Electron, która będzie instalowalna, natomiast backend w takiej sytuacji powinieneś hostować na zewnątrz. Aplikacja w Electron to HTML, CSS i JS, a więc frontend, który może się komunikować z backendem w PHP.
@loginek0: takie rzeczy to nie w #php , ale jeśli się uprzesz:
https://www.ioncube.com
ale nie chcę aby mógł podglądnąć/skopiować/edytować kod.
https://www.ioncube.com
- 0
Mam dwie rozwijane listy z danymi z dwóch tabel users i orders i teraz chce zapisać te wybrane zlecenia do użytkownika poprzez rekord user_id w tabeli orders. może ktoś mnie nakierować? próbowałem przez samo zapytanie SQL ale nie wiem czy to jest w ogóle możliwe?
#php #naukaprogramowania #mysql #programowanie #bazydanych
#php #naukaprogramowania #mysql #programowanie #bazydanych
- 0
ale ja chcę, żeby zmieniało z tymi danymi które zostaną wybrane z rozwijanej listy. Próbowalem w ten sposób
if(isset($POST['submit'])){
if(isset($POST['select1'])){
$userselected = $POST['select1'];
$orderselected =
if(isset($POST['submit'])){
if(isset($POST['select1'])){
$userselected = $POST['select1'];
$orderselected =
- 0
@ascirkn: no to robisz tak jak podałem UPDATE, tylko pod x podstawiasz $userselected a pod y dajesz $orderselected. A ogólnie później poczytaj o PDO, bo to co robisz jest niebezpieczne i mocno podatne na hackowanie.
- 60
Cześć! Szukasz niezawodnego hostingu www?
Sprawdź naszą ofertę na sohost®
Z kodem WYKOP hosting 25% taniej!
W
Sprawdź naszą ofertę na sohost®
Z kodem WYKOP hosting 25% taniej!
W
- 0
Jest jakaś gotowa aplikacja w postaci webowej nakładki do podpięcia do bazy #mysql ?
Zbieram trochę danych na #raspberrypi i chciałbym móc łatwo je sobie czasami "wyklikać" i zobaczyć na wykresach. phpMyAdmin zbytnio zamula przy takiej ilości danych :(
Zbieram trochę danych na #raspberrypi i chciałbym móc łatwo je sobie czasami "wyklikać" i zobaczyć na wykresach. phpMyAdmin zbytnio zamula przy takiej ilości danych :(
Adminer?
@Ranger: Grafana
- 0
Spotkał się ktoś z problemami w MySQL 8.0.22? Mam przenieść bazy z 8.0.16 na najnowsze wydanie i próbowałem już wszystkiego: upgrade in place, ładowanie dumpów na czysto, docker, wirtualizacja, "instalacja" z tarbala na boku. No ni uja.
Konkretne zapytania (duże, np do widoków), wywoływanie triggerów - ubija serwer.
Śledząc wątki na mysql, to ziomki zwalają na "wina sprzętowa". Uja nie sprzętowa, bo w logach nie ma, pamięci przetestowane, dyski też. Na 5.7
Konkretne zapytania (duże, np do widoków), wywoływanie triggerów - ubija serwer.
Śledząc wątki na mysql, to ziomki zwalają na "wina sprzętowa". Uja nie sprzętowa, bo w logach nie ma, pamięci przetestowane, dyski też. Na 5.7
- 0
- 0
Hej mirki z #naukaprogramowania #informatyka #mysql
Mógłby ktoś podpowiedzieć jak przy liczeniu rekordów dodać warunek, że licz tylko tych co mają tę samą pierwszą literę nazwy?
Mógłby ktoś podpowiedzieć jak przy liczeniu rekordów dodać warunek, że licz tylko tych co mają tę samą pierwszą literę nazwy?
- 1
@krolwsi: może coś takiego: SELECT
LEFT(ProductName, 1) AS p,
COUNT(*) AS ilosc
FROM Tabela
GROUP BY p
LEFT(ProductName, 1) AS p,
COUNT(*) AS ilosc
FROM Tabela
GROUP BY p
- 1
Mam prostą bazę w #mysql, gdzie zbieram sobie dane z czujnika. Są to:
idurządzenia, temp, wilgotność, coś tam jeszcze.
Wpisów mam już dość dużo (około 100mln - nie pytać czemu, tak ma być :) ). Zastanawiam się nad zmianą silnika bazodanowego, aby w przyszłości to działało szybko. Aktualnie gdy pobieram dane do wykresów czy jakiś obliczeń to trwa to już coraz dłużej. Co byście polecili? Myślałem o NoSQL
idurządzenia, temp, wilgotność, coś tam jeszcze.
Wpisów mam już dość dużo (około 100mln - nie pytać czemu, tak ma być :) ). Zastanawiam się nad zmianą silnika bazodanowego, aby w przyszłości to działało szybko. Aktualnie gdy pobieram dane do wykresów czy jakiś obliczeń to trwa to już coraz dłużej. Co byście polecili? Myślałem o NoSQL
Miruny sprawa:
Mam sobie bazę danych w MySQLu. Może spora nie jest ~500 MB, ale gdy jednocześnie trwa do niej zapis i odczyt pewnych rekordów, a w nim jeszcze joiny i inne wynalazki to niestety, ale to się bardzo muli ( ͡° ʖ̯ ͡°) a dyski nie są SSD tylko starsze SASy ( ͡° ʖ̯ ͡°) i nie mam możliwości zmiany.
Istnieje coś, żeby można było mieć na jednym serwerze
Mam sobie bazę danych w MySQLu. Może spora nie jest ~500 MB, ale gdy jednocześnie trwa do niej zapis i odczyt pewnych rekordów, a w nim jeszcze joiny i inne wynalazki to niestety, ale to się bardzo muli ( ͡° ʖ̯ ͡°) a dyski nie są SSD tylko starsze SASy ( ͡° ʖ̯ ͡°) i nie mam możliwości zmiany.
Istnieje coś, żeby można było mieć na jednym serwerze
@super_tux: analizowales czy wąskim gardłem nie jest sam zapis? Z tego co piszesz pewnie gro zapisu to coś a'la random write, co efektywnie zjada iopsy dysków. Jeśli potrzeba ich więcej niż dyski są w stanie dać to replika in-memory nie rozwiąże problemu.
Hmm nie możecie zmienić dysków na SSD. Masz tam BBU?
Hmm nie możecie zmienić dysków na SSD. Masz tam BBU?
- 1
@super_tux: I być może jeszcze to będzie pomocne: https://www.percona.com/blog/2017/01/06/millions-queries-per-second-postgresql-and-mysql-peaceful-battle-at-modern-demanding-workloads/
Jak najprościej dodać brakujące miesiące, bo teraz jak nie ma rekordu w jakimyś miesiącu to mam lukę :/
SELECT
MONTH(date) AS month,
SUM(total) AS total
FROM table1
SELECT
MONTH(date) AS month,
SUM(total) AS total
FROM table1
- 2
@bla_bla_bla: utworzyć tabelkę z miesiącami i zrobić join ?
- 0
@noHuman:kurcze że też o tym nie pomyślałem :)
Jak najprościej wygenerować crud dla istniejącej relacyjnej bazy danych? #mysql #programowanie
Najlepiej korzystając z języka skryptowego jak #php #ruby #python
Jeden typ męczy mi o to doope jakby nie mógł sobie sam tego zrobić i już mam dość jego telefonów i maili.
Najlepiej korzystając z języka skryptowego jak #php #ruby #python
Jeden typ męczy mi o to doope jakby nie mógł sobie sam tego zrobić i już mam dość jego telefonów i maili.
- 1
@incydent_kakaowy: inne opcje: Symfony + easy admin > Laravel + Voyager
@incydent_kakaowy: zależy co dokładnie ma być zrobione, ale jeśli to ma być CRUDowy panel admina, to obczaj ActiveAdmin (#ruby). Wielu nie lubi tego rozwiązania, ale jedno jest pewne - da się szybko postawić działający panel, praktycznie bez programowania go samemu.
Import dużej bazy danych MySQL (MariaDB) za pomocą CLI
Kiedy baza danych zaczyna się rozrastać, ciężkie staje się używanie GUI (np. #phpmyadmin) podczas importów wielkich bazodanowych zrzutów. Na szczęście można użyć do tego #cli. Życie od razu staje się prostsze.
#webroad #mysql #mariadb
Kiedy baza danych zaczyna się rozrastać, ciężkie staje się używanie GUI (np. #phpmyadmin) podczas importów wielkich bazodanowych zrzutów. Na szczęście można użyć do tego #cli. Życie od razu staje się prostsze.
#webroad #mysql #mariadb
źródło: comment_1604394061RZvqODaJMIpZPnTJFgFlEO.jpg
Pobierz- 1
@michalkortas: ktos normalny robie import/export baz powyzej 10M/20M przez phpadmina?
Miruny
bawię się od jakiegoś czasu w #php i #symfony
do pewnego momentu bawiłem się używając XAMPa do stawiania lokalnego serwa do wykorzystania bazy danych #mysql, ale zamarzyło mi się spróbować sił w konteneryzacji i użycie #docker i obrazów mysql oraz phpmyadmin do stawiania bazy danych w kontenerze.
Wszystko fruwa, śmiga i działa. Jestem w stanie przez przeglądarkę podejrzeć sobie bazę danych na localhoście, ale kiedy
bawię się od jakiegoś czasu w #php i #symfony
do pewnego momentu bawiłem się używając XAMPa do stawiania lokalnego serwa do wykorzystania bazy danych #mysql, ale zamarzyło mi się spróbować sił w konteneryzacji i użycie #docker i obrazów mysql oraz phpmyadmin do stawiania bazy danych w kontenerze.
Wszystko fruwa, śmiga i działa. Jestem w stanie przez przeglądarkę podejrzeć sobie bazę danych na localhoście, ale kiedy
co mam wpisać w kolumny oddzielone? gdy zostawiam domyślnie przecinek to mam napisane ze niewłaściwa suma kolumn w 1 linii ?
#bazydanych #mysql #informatyka
#bazydanych #mysql #informatyka
źródło: comment_16032890570VqFtBHeygmGe1jMs2V0l3.jpg
Pobierz- 0
@b0b3k: nie wiem patrze na to i wedlug mnie wszystko jest okej, nie wiem czy blad jest w jakiejs zakladce w importowaniu czy w samej bazie
- 1
@Bumbel_xen możliwe, ze ten plik ma dziwne kodowanie (BOM) i na samym jego początku są jakieś artefakty z tym związane
Pytanie w temacie baz danych. Załóżmy że mam w bazie MySQL tabele „pojazdy” przechowującą informacje techniczne takie jak id pojazdu, id właściciela itp, załóżmy że taka tabela techniczna jest niezbędna. Mamy tez tabele takie jak „samochody”, „motocykle”, „ciężarówki” itp, czyli tabele przechowujące dane charakterystyczne dla danego typu pojazdu, te tabele są połączone FK do tabeli pojazdy po id pojazdu. Oczywiście każdej pozycji w tabeli pojazdy może odpowiadać łącznie jeden rekord we wszystkich
- 1
@atm-Pa: Dodatkowa tabela z unique. Jeśli można do niej dodać, to można dodać do docelowej tabeli. Jeśli nie, to już jest.
- 1
@atm-Pa: Niekoniecznie.
Dodajesz motor, dostaje numer 1. Do tabeli dane wstawiasz (idpojazdu, rodzaj, wartosc ) values ( 1, "pojemnosc", "200cc" ), (1, "szybkosc", "200km/h" )
Dodajesz ciężarówkę, numer 2. (idpojazdu, rodzaj, wartosc ) values ( 2, "wysokosc", "2.5m"), ( 2, "szerokosc", "1.5m" )
Przy wyświetlaniu i edycji tylko musisz uwzględnić to, że będą różne pola.
Dodajesz motor, dostaje numer 1. Do tabeli dane wstawiasz (idpojazdu, rodzaj, wartosc ) values ( 1, "pojemnosc", "200cc" ), (1, "szybkosc", "200km/h" )
Dodajesz ciężarówkę, numer 2. (idpojazdu, rodzaj, wartosc ) values ( 2, "wysokosc", "2.5m"), ( 2, "szerokosc", "1.5m" )
Przy wyświetlaniu i edycji tylko musisz uwzględnić to, że będą różne pola.
- 19
Cześć! Szukasz niezawodnego hostingu www?
Sprawdź naszą ofertę na sohost.com
Z kodem WYKOP hosting 25% taniej!
W
Sprawdź naszą ofertę na sohost.com
Z kodem WYKOP hosting 25% taniej!
W
Hejka, mam problem z Presta Shop, chodzi mi o to, że mam ucięte formularze np. dodawania produkty przez co nie mogę uzupełnić poniektórych sekcji, da się ustawić tak, aby formularz był zgodny z rozmiarem ekranu?
#prestashop #mysql #php #programowanie
#prestashop #mysql #php #programowanie
źródło: comment_1600616083kvr12SBOfjPJ5hzpgQcMrk.jpg
Pobierz@BiletNaKrucjate:
Jeśli problem dotyczy tylko danej strony produktu to sprawdź jakie moduły są do niej przypięte i je wyłączaj sprawdzając, bo możliwe, że któryś ma niepoprawne style, albo źle się domyka. Wtedy trzeba by spojrzeć do kodu tego modułu w CSS.
Jeśli problem dotyczy tylko danej strony produktu to sprawdź jakie moduły są do niej przypięte i je wyłączaj sprawdzając, bo możliwe, że któryś ma niepoprawne style, albo źle się domyka. Wtedy trzeba by spojrzeć do kodu tego modułu w CSS.
- 1
@BiletNaKrucjate: cała ta strona wygląda źle, tj. w normalnej działającej wersji PrestaShop wygląda to całkowicie inaczej, prawdopodobnie masz jakieś problemy związane z ładowaniem CSS, JS lub przez moduły firm trzecich. W konsoli przeglądarki powinny być jakieś wskazówki.
Dodatkowo warto upewnić się, że Twoje środowisko spełnia wymagania PrestaShop, czyli, że wersja PHP jest kompatybilna itd.
Dodatkowo warto upewnić się, że Twoje środowisko spełnia wymagania PrestaShop, czyli, że wersja PHP jest kompatybilna itd.
Ktoś wie może dlaczego te seedy nie chcą działać? Kiedy wpisuje komenda migracji to działa. Co najlepsze chwile wcześniej działały. Hasło jest a wg Sequelize CI go nie ma :( #nodejs #programowanie #javascript #expressjs #mysql
źródło: comment_1599666551iMweurKfJ6qNNvGnofUzWq.jpg
Pobierz- 0
@asus1234: drugie
źródło: comment_15996665688CDte2JdYiLm1c8Axkr4vm.jpg
Pobierz@asus1234: wklejasz config produkcyjny a odwołujesz się do środowiska development

























